Driving Revenue: A Track Record of Sales Success
When it comes to sales, numbers speak louder than words. Employers want to see concrete evidence of your ability to drive revenue and achieve sales targets. Include specific examples of your sales success, such as exceeding quotas, generating new leads, or increasing sales volume. Quantify your achievements whenever possible, using percentages or dollar amounts to demonstrate the impact you have made in previous roles.

1. How can I highlight my sales experience on a resume?
- Include specific numbers and metrics to quantify your achievements, such as the percentage increase in sales you achieved or the number of new clients you brought in.
- Showcase your ability to build relationships with customers by mentioning any customer satisfaction ratings or positive feedback you received.
- Highlight any relevant training or certifications you have completed, such as sales techniques or product knowledge courses.
2. What skills should I include on a Sales Associate Resume?
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ills to effectively engage with customers and meet their needs.
- Strong product knowledge to provide accurate information and recommendations to customers.
- Proven ability to meet sales targets and drive revenue growth.
- Attention to detail and organizational skills to handle administrative tasks, such as inventory management.
- Customer service skills to ensure customer satisfaction and build long-term relationships.
3. How do I format my Sales Associate Resume?
- Start with a professional summary or objective statement that highlights your relevant experience and skills.
- List your work experience in reverse chronological order, including the company name, job title, dates of employment, and key responsibilities and achievements.
- Include a separate section for your education, mentioning any relevant degrees or certifications.
- Add a skills section where you can list specific sales-related skills, such as negotiation or product demonstration abilities.
4. Should I include references on my Sales Associate Resume?
- It is generally not necessary to include references on your resume. Instead, you can provide them upon request during the interview process.
- If you do choose to include references, make sure to inform the individuals beforehand and provide their contact information, professional titles, and a brief description of your relationship with them.
5. How can I tailor my Sales Associate Resume for a specific job?
- Research the job requirements and incorporate relevant keywords from the job description into your resume.
- Highlight the skills and experiences that align with the specific needs of the employer.
- Showcase any previous experience in the industry or with similar products.
- Customize your professional summary or objective statement to emphasize why you are a strong fit for the specific role.
